Output c942f2a9c496a55b4e996fa55d254b2758a05fe5384d7c338d1556444dfc8de6:5

value
109291554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b381207196b9a7bb3f4a63c2a4a73758af30987 OP_EQUAL
address
3QbLhXwjEs2bhqv4VD3gomu7ou2Lnu8Tx1
transaction
c942f2a9c496a55b4e996fa55d254b2758a05fe5384d7c338d1556444dfc8de6
spent
true